The use of higher quality feeds in fish farming demands better feeding technique. Optimal growth of fish and optimal use of feed is only possible with exact rationing of feed, waste-free feeding and multiple daily feeds. It is difficult and expen sive to achieve these objectives with manual feeding. In addition, automatic feeding considerably reduces working hours and it makes the work easier!

As a result, LINN Gerätebau has developed the Profi-feed sprayer. With this device it is possible to spread the feed into the pond without waste. The feed is put into the air-stream of a powerful blower and with the assistance of this airstream it is distributed across the pond up to a dis tance of 8 m. The LINN feed sprayer guarantees a maintenance-free and trouble-free operation and virtually abrasion free feed distribution (in contrast to centrifugal discs).

The Profi-feed sprayer is suitable for feed of 2-7 mm. The portioning finger at the outlet of the feed container (specially developed for this use) guarantees a consistent portion, and free flow of the feed. Clogging is virtually impossible. At the outlet of the feed container is a meter with scales. Thus, it is possible to adjust the size of the feed pellet quickly and easily, even when the hopper is full.

The standard version of the feed sprayer comes with a special timer with display. This timer is protected by a robust casing sited next to the feed hopper. If preferred, it is possible to have several hoppers controlled by a centralised controller. Adjustments are easy. There is an additional on/off button to turn the sprayer off completely. Thus, it is possible to control the amount of feed and the number of feedings.

Feeding in Aquaculture

Feeding represents one of the major maintenance costs in a fish farm. Developed methods for fish rearing are divided into the following 3 categories according to feeding dispensation: hand, automatic and demand feeding. The first one is an old and high labor cost method, while the second one is widely used nowadays although it causes an overfeeding in cultured fish. The last one is a recent method which has been developed sufficiently in experimental scale but its application in farms is still restricted. It has been applied in several fish species of fresh or sea water and the results are promising.

In the Mediterranean aquaculture industry, with a huge production of warm water marine species in the last twenty years, automatic feeding preceded the demand systems. The knowledge on the latter system was restricted. Demand feeders are controlled by the fish themselves according to their appetite. These feeders are easy to install and operate.
